A. Basements under Main Buildings. Basements are permitted under a main building. The total allowed floor area for all basements under a main building shall be the same as the total floor area of the first floor of the building (e.g., maximum floor area for basements under a main building is one hundred percent of the floor area of the first floor of the main building). Additionally, the location of all basements as part of a main building shall be limited to the boundaries of the footprint of the first floor of the main building. Minor extensions of the basement beyond the first floor footprint above may be approved at a staff level for extensions that are no greater than one hundred forty square feet in combined area. However, because not all main buildings are exact rectangles, the approval authority (the planning commission as described in Table 17.06.070-1) may allow, through issuance of a special structures permit, exceptions to this rule when within the following parameters:

1. The total floor area of basements shall not exceed one hundred twenty percent of the total floor area of the first floor of the main building; and

2. A minimum of seventy-five percent of the total area of the basements shall be located directly under the footprint of the first floor of the main building; and

3. Portions of basements that are not located directly under the footprint of the first floor of the main building shall only be allowed in such locations when they are still within the extents of the main building (e.g., “squaring off” the basement).

B. Basement under Accessory Buildings. Nonhabitable basements without lightwell(s) may be located under the footprint of accessory buildings outside of the main building area with no more than one exterior stair accessing the basement level. The exterior stair must be located within the allowable buildable area for accessory buildings. No windows are permitted in these basements. Basements containing habitable space with lightwell(s) may be located under the footprint of accessory buildings outside of the main building area with a special structures permit from the approval authority with the finding that the basement will not impact heritage trees and the condition that lightwells be located on the interior side of the yard, or the lightwell shall comply with the main building setbacks if facing an exterior yard. The approval authority may impose reasonable conditions including, but not limited to, increased setbacks and limitation on the size of lightwells.

C. Garages in Basements. Garages may be located in basements under buildings located within the main building area. (Ord. 616 § 1, 2015; Ord. 582 § 1 (Exh. A (part)), 2009)
